Too much histamine in your body? Headaches, itching, hives, swelling, flushing, racing heart, digestion problems, irritability - if any of these sounds familiar, then perhaps you have Histamine Intolerance. It's stressful to go to the doctor and know that even he can't immediately confirm the diagnosis. Controlling your diet might be a first solution to making your life normal. You can learn the following from this cookbook: Recognize and eliminate the causes of histamine intolerance. How to safely choose the correct foods. What not to eat under any circumstances! What you can definitely eat! How to permanently change your diet in order to achieve a healthy and symptom-free life. Feel noticeable relief when you finally get this problem under control! Is that what you want? And also you will have: Recipes for every time of the day: breakfast, Lunch, Dinner, Snacks, Desserts, Soups, Salads Are you Vegan or vegetarian? You will have also recipes for you. Don't let waiting for your doctor's response decide when you will be able to feel well, but start allowing yourself the well-being of normal life just by following the right diet without restrictions.

Jenny Ellery was born in New Jersey. When she was young, doctors diagnosed her with heart problems, so her parents often took her to hospitals and doctors' offices for check-ups and examinations. Her childhood was quite lonely because she couldn't enjoy running and playing like all the other children because she quickly became tired and felt palpitations. During her teenage years, she was lucky enough to be in a school where the teachers liked to organize Tai-Chi sessions, which they considered to be a good sport for the mind and body, so Jenny noticed that there was more to fun than running and that there were different ways of loving sport and life. Therefore Jenny became aware of her limitations and realized that she, is not her limitations and that all she had to do was open her mind and be more imaginative and curious to try different things. Jenny is now married, has two girls, and works as an assistant in a dietician's office. She is very familiar with the problems of heart disease and depression, which can occur in the long term in people who feel frail and consequently increasingly weak, so for years, she has used her free time to give advice and moral support to the American Heart Association. Jenny keeps fit by doing yoga, stretching, and taking long walks on the beach while listening to music. Although she doesn't say so as not to worry her husband, she often suffers from a lack of appetite, so even when preparing food for herself and her family, she prefers light, healthy food that doesn't weigh her down. She knows very well that healthy eating can save our lives.
